The Céide Fields, near Ballycastle, certainly gives you a unique experience. For this is not just another archaeological monument or visitor centre. Here you can indulge yourself in a vast prehistoric landscape, a natural wild ecology of blanket bog, dramatic cliffs and coastline, and a much acclaimed building, which has received Ireland's most prestigious architectural award.

The simplicity of the fields conceals the fact that here is the most extensive Stone Age monument in the world located in an extra-ordinary position.

Three elements make Ceide Fields interesting: Archaeology, Geology and Botany.

The experience of walking again in these ancient fields, which have been buried for almonst fifty centuries… that is what Ceide Fields is about.
